When developing a residential landscape, one of the most crucial action is to place an intend on paper. Creating a plan of attack will save you money and time and is more probable to lead to a successful design. A master strategy is created via the 'style process': a detailed approach that takes into consideration the environmental conditions, your wishes, and the aspects and principles of design.


How Landscapers can Save You Time, Stress, and Money.


The 5 actions of the design process include: 1) conducting a site supply and evaluation, 2) establishing your needs, 3) developing functional diagrams, 4) establishing theoretical layout strategies, and 5) drawing a last style strategy. The initial three actions develop the visual, functional, and horticultural demands for the style. The last two steps then use those requirements to the production of the final landscape plan.

Topography and drain ought to additionally be noted and all drainage problems remedied in the recommended design. An excellent layout will certainly relocate water away from the house and re-route it to various other locations of the lawn. Environment problems start with temperature: plants have to have the ability to endure the typical high and, most importantly, the ordinary low temperatures for the area.


Sun/shade patterns, the quantity and length of direct exposure to sunlight or color (Number 1), create microclimates (occasionally called microhabitats). Recording website conditions and existing plant life on a base map will disclose the place of microclimates in the backyard. Plants generally come under one or two of four microclimate categories-full sun, partial color, color, and deep color.

This is called "local color", which means it fits with the surroundings. There are both type themes and style themes. Every garden must have a kind theme, yet not all yards have a style theme. Several residential yards have no particular design other than to blend with the home by duplicating details from the design such as materials, shade, and form (Landscapers).


In a form theme the organization and shape of the spaces in the backyard is based either on the shape of the house, the shape of the locations between your house and the home boundaries, or a favorite shape of the home owner. The type motif figures out the form and organization (the design) of the spaces and the links between them.
